Lift car buffering device

By designing a car buffer device with components such as electric push rods and guide rods, the problem of elevator car swaying when people enter and exit on the first floor was solved, achieving comfortable riding and extended structural life.

Abstract

The utility model belongs to the technical field of elevator equipment, and particularly relates to a car buffering device which comprises a buffering support, a supporting plate is arranged at the top of the buffering support, two sets of bevel grooves are formed in the bottom of the support and correspond to each other, a jacking piece is arranged on the inner side of the buffering support, and the jacking piece comprises an electric push rod located on the inner side of the buffering support. The output end of the electric push rod is fixedly connected with a driving block, the surface of the driving block is in a slope shape, the slope is located at the bottom of the slope groove and attached to the slope groove, moving wheels are installed at the bottom of the driving block, the moving wheels are distributed at the bottom of the driving block at equal intervals, and the two sets of jacking pieces correspond to each other. According to the lift car buffering device, the distance between the buffering support and the lift car can be increased, then the phenomenon that the lift car makes contact with the buffering structure and triggers the buffering structure to operate due to pressure generated when a person walks can be avoided, the comfort degree of the person can be improved, on the contrary, the worker can conveniently overhaul the buffering structure, and then the working efficiency can be improved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of elevator equipment technology, and in particular to a car buffer device. Background Technology

[0002] A car buffer device is a device installed above the elevator car to reduce the impact and vibration that occurs when the elevator car is moving up or down, making the elevator ride more stable and comfortable for passengers.

[0003] Currently, most elevator car buffer devices are installed inside the shaft pit. When the elevator reaches the first floor, the bottom of the elevator car will contact the buffer device. At the same time, when people inside the car enter or exit the elevator, they will exert pressure on the elevator, which will trigger the buffer device to operate, causing the car to shake up and down, affecting the comfort of passengers. [0030] like Figures 1 to 6 As shown in the figure, this embodiment provides a car buffer device, which includes a buffer support 1, a support plate 2 on the top of the buffer support 1, and an inclined groove 101 on the bottom of the buffer support 1. There are two sets of inclined grooves 101 that correspond to each other, and a lifting member is provided on the inner side of the buffer support 1.

[0031] The lifting component includes an electric push rod 3 located inside the buffer support 1. The output end of the electric push rod 3 is fixedly connected to a drive block 4. The surface of the drive block 4 is in the shape of an inclined surface 5. The inclined surface 5 is located at the bottom of the inclined groove 101 and fits against it. The bottom of the drive block 4 is equipped with moving wheels 6, which are evenly distributed at the bottom of the drive block 4. The lifting component is provided in two sets, which correspond to each other and correspond to the inclined groove 101. The lifting component is located inside the shaft pit, and the buffer support 1 is located inside the shaft pit and fits against its inner side. The height of the buffer support 1 can be adjusted by setting the lifting component. By lowering the buffer support 1, it can be moved away from the bottom of the car, avoiding the car from contacting the buffer structure and thus easily triggering its movement. In addition, by raising the buffer support 1, it is convenient to inspect and maintain the buffer structure.

[0032] A housing 7 is fixedly connected to the inner side of the buffer support 1. The housings 7 are evenly distributed at the four corners of the buffer support 1 and are inclined at 45 degrees. A slide rod 8 is fixedly connected inside the housing 7. A buffer spring 9 is sleeved on the surface of the slide rod 8. A buffer plate 10 is fixedly connected to the top of the buffer spring 9. The bottom of the buffer spring 9 is fixedly connected to the housing 7. The buffer plate 10 can drive the operation of the buffer spring 9, thereby achieving the purpose of buffering. At the same time, the slide rod 8 can also give the buffer spring 9 a guiding force, preventing it from getting tangled when squeezed.

[0033] One end of the buffer plate 10 extends to the outside of the housing 7. A guide groove 701 is provided on the inner side of the housing 7. Guide blocks 1001 are fixedly connected to both sides of the buffer plate 10. The guide blocks 1001 are located inside the guide groove 701 and are movably connected to it, which can ensure the stability of the buffer plate 10 when it is raised and lowered, and prevent it from getting stuck on the surface of the slide bar 8.

[0034] The two sets of corresponding buffer plates 10 are fixedly connected at the ends away from the housing 7 by connecting plates 11. There are two sets of connecting plates 11, which cross each other and form an X shape, which can more evenly disperse the impact force of the car.

[0035] The inner side of the buffer support 1 is provided with a base plate 12, which is located between two sets of lifting members. Both ends of the base plate 12 are fixedly connected to the buffer support 1. A lower shell 13 is fixedly connected to the surface of the base plate 12. An upper shell 14 is provided on the top of the lower shell 13. One end of the upper shell 14 is located inside the lower shell 13 and is fixedly connected to it. A compression spring 15 is fixedly connected inside the lower shell 13.

[0036] An extrusion block 16 is movably connected inside the upper shell 14. A bearing plate 17 is provided on the top of the upper shell 14. The extrusion block 16 passes through the upper shell 14, and its two ends are fixedly connected to the compression spring 15 and the bearing plate 17, respectively. The bearing plate 17 is located at the bottom of the connecting plate 11 and is fixedly connected to it. It can provide buffering force for the central part of the connecting plate 11, and avoid the connecting plate 11 relying solely on the buffering structure at the four corners of the buffer support 1 for buffering, thereby evenly dispersing the impact force of the car.

[0037] The inner side of the support plate 2 is fixedly connected to the force plate 18 and the first guide rod 19. The force plate 18 is cross-shaped, and the first guide rod 19 is evenly distributed at the four corners of the support plate 2. The end of the first guide rod 19 away from the support plate 2 is fixedly connected to the buffer plate 10 and the connecting plate 11.

[0038] A second guide rod 20 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the force plate 18. The bottom of the second guide rod 20 is fixedly connected to the connecting plate 11, which can prevent the car from directly contacting the buffer spring 9 and the compression spring 15, thereby extending the service life of the buffer spring 9 and the compression spring 15, and at the same time, it can make the impact force of the car more evenly distributed.

[0039] In use, the electric push rod 3 can be activated to retract, causing the drive block 4 to move towards the electric push rod 3. The inclined surface 5 of the drive block 4 slowly separates from the buffer support 1. As the drive block 4 separates and due to its own weight, the buffer support 1 slowly contacts the surface of the pit until one end of the drive block 4 is completely disconnected from the inclined groove 101, and the buffer support 1 is in complete contact with the ground. This increases the distance between the buffer support 1 and the car, thus preventing the pressure generated by personnel walking from causing the car to contact the buffer structure and trigger its operation, thereby improving the comfort of personnel.

[0040] Conversely, the electric push rod 3 can be activated to push the drive block 4 towards the inclined groove 101, so that it slowly lifts the buffer support 1, which can facilitate the maintenance of the buffer structure by the staff and thus improve work efficiency.

[0041] When the car is damaged and falls, it will directly contact the support plate 2. The force plate 18 can strengthen the support plate 2 and distribute the impact force of the support plate 2. When the support plate 2 is impacted, it will descend through the first guide rod 19 and the second guide rod 20, causing the connecting plate 11 to descend as a whole. During the descent, the connecting plate 11 will drive the buffer plate 10 to slide down along the surface of the slide rod 8 and compress the buffer spring 9 to deform it, thereby achieving the purpose of dispersing the impact force.

[0042] Simultaneously, when the connecting plate 11 descends, it also disperses the impact force to the extrusion block 16 through the bearing plate 17. As it descends, the compression spring 15 is compressed and deformed, thus dispersing the impact force at the center of the connecting plate 11. When used in conjunction with the buffer spring 9, the impact force can be dispersed more evenly, improving the overall buffering effect. Furthermore, through the combined use of the first guide rod 19, the second guide rod 20, the extrusion block 16, the connecting plate 11, and the force-bearing plate 18, the impact force of the car can be prevented from directly contacting the buffer spring 9 and the compression spring 15, making the stress and wear of both more even, thereby increasing their service life.
